Leadership Review Briefing — Second-Source Supplier Search

Vellan Fixtures remains our sole supplier for shelving components, which poses continuity risk. Procurement has shortlisted two alternative manufacturers, Ostrem Metalworks and Calloway Fabrication, and site visits are scheduled next month. Branch managers should not discuss the search externally. The rationale is set out in the confidential note that follows.

board note of bajop-yaweg: The western region missed its Pelys quota by 58.0 percent last quarter. Pelysek Foods plans to raise the Belius list price by 44.0 percent in July. The steering committee signed off on a budget of $133.8 million for Project Pelax. The renewal with Zoraelix Systems closes at $61.9 million a year, 12.7 percent above the last contract.

## Formula sandbox tuning

User-supplied formulas in Gridmoor execute inside a restricted interpreter with hard ceilings on time, memory, and call depth. Reviewers should confirm any change to these ceilings is justified in the PR description, since raising them widens the abuse surface. Defaults were chosen from production traces. The current limits are as follows.

limits module of tafog-fawip:
WEIGHTS = {
    "julix": 57,
    "lamys": 992,
    "kasvan": 209,
    "quenok": 750,
    "alddor": 259,
    "oliath": 1009,
    "wenix": 815,
}

The root cause is the styling pass, which requires a second traversal and therefore keeps all rows resident. Proposed fix: precompute styles per column and switch to the streaming writer. Reproduction requires the large-tenant fixture. The profiling run that captured the allocation spike is recorded under the token below.

trace token, fafog-kageg: htk4_98e6

# Strandmap Environments

Strandmap, our dependency graph visualizer, runs in three environments: sandbox, staging, and production. Support should know that graph rendering in sandbox uses sample data only, so customer tickets about missing edges there are expected. Staging mirrors production nightly. Production reads the live package index and boots with the following values.

settings of tagef-bawif:
DRUIX_HOST=druix.zemvarlabs.internal
DRUIX_PORT=8000